#664b80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#664b80 is composed of 40% red, 29.4%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.3%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 270.6 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 39.8%. #664b80 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c96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#664b80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#664b80 has RGB values of R:102, G:75,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 6704000.

Shades and Tints of #664b80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030304 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#664b80
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666269 is the less saturated color, while #6705c6 is the most saturated one.
